format(string, sizeof(string),"(( Admin Nivel 1(ID: %d) %s: %s ))",playerid, sendername, result);
OOCOff(ColorAdmin1,string);
printf("%s",string);
}
if(PlayerInfo[playerid][pAdmin] == 2)
{
format(string, sizeof(string),"(( Admin Nivel 2(ID: %d) %s: %s ))",playerid, sendername, result);
OOCOff(ColorAdmin2,string);
printf("%s",string);
}
if(PlayerInfo[playerid][pAdmin] >= 3)
{
format(string, sizeof(string),"(( Admin Nivel 3 (ID: %d) %s: %s ))",playerid, sendername, result);
OOCOff(ColorAdmin3,string);
printf("%s",string);
}
if(PlayerInfo[playerid][pAdmin] == 4)
{
format(string, sizeof(string),"(( Admin Nivel 4(ID: %d) %s: %s ))",playerid, sendername, result);
OOCOff(ColorAdmin4,string);
printf("%s",string);
}
ola amigos les cuento que tengo un problema con los canales de administracion cuando mando 1 mensaje siendo admin 2 tambien envia otro siendo admin 3 por que pasa esto? aka les dejo el codigo creo que es algo de aka
pawn Код:
|
format(string, sizeof(string),"(( Admin Nivel 1(ID: %d) %s: %s ))",playerid, sendername, result);
OOCOff(ColorAdmin1,string);
printf("%s",string);
}
if(PlayerInfo[playerid][pAdmin] == 2)
{
format(string, sizeof(string),"(( Admin Nivel 2 (ID: %d) %s: %s ))",playerid, sendername, result);
OOCOff(ColorAdmin2,string);
printf("%s",string);
}
if(PlayerInfo[playerid][pAdmin] == 3)
{
format(string, sizeof(string),"(( Admin Nivel 3(ID: %d) %s: %s ))",playerid, sendername, result);
OOCOff(ColorAdmin3,string);
printf("%s",string);
}
if(PlayerInfo[playerid][pAdmin] == 4)
{
format(string, sizeof(string),"(( Admin Nivel 4(ID: %d) %s: %s ))",playerid, sendername, result);
OOCOff(ColorAdmin4,string);
printf("%s",string);
}
new textonivel[20];
switch(PlayerInfo[playerid][pAdmin]){
case 2:{textonivel="Nivel 2";} //es administrador nivel 2
case 3:{textonivel="Nivel 3";} //es administrador nivel 3
case 4:{textonivel="Nivel 4";} //es administrador nivel 4
//ETC...
}
format(string, sizeof(string),"(( Admin %s(ID: %d) %s: %s ))",textonivel, playerid, sendername, result);
OOCOff(ColorAdmin1,string);
format(string, sizeof(string),"(( Admin Nivel %d(ID: %d) %s: %s ))",PlayerInfo[playerid][pAdmin], playerid, sendername, result);
OOCOff(ColorAdmin1,string);